Overview

Conductive brass rods are cylindrical bars made from brass, a copper-zinc alloy. They are highly valued in industrial applications for their combination of electrical conductivity and mechanical strength. Brass rods are commonly used in electrical and electronic components, as well as in mechanical systems where durability and precision are required. The alloy composition can vary, but typical brass rods contain 60-70% copper and 30-40% zinc. This balance ensures optimal conductivity while maintaining good tensile strength and resistance to wear. Brass rods are available in various diameters and lengths to suit different industrial needs.

Structure and Working Principle

Conductive brass rods are solid cylindrical structures, often precision-machined to meet specific dimensional tolerances. Their working principle is based on the inherent electrical conductivity of brass, which allows efficient transfer of electrical current. The copper content in brass provides high conductivity, while zinc enhances mechanical properties such as hardness and corrosion resistance. The uniform microstructure of brass ensures consistent performance across the rod, making it ideal for applications requiring reliable electrical connections.

Key Features

Conductive brass rods offer several key features that make them suitable for industrial use. These include high electrical conductivity, excellent machinability, and resistance to corrosion. Brass rods can be easily cut, drilled, and threaded, allowing for customization to fit specific applications. Additionally, brass rods have good thermal conductivity, making them useful in heat dissipation applications. Their natural gold-like appearance also makes them aesthetically pleasing for visible components in consumer electronics and decorative hardware.

Application Areas

Conductive brass rods are widely used in electrical and electronic industries for connectors, terminals, and busbars. They are also employed in mechanical systems for bushings, bearings, and precision shafts due to their wear resistance. In the automotive sector, brass rods are used in electrical systems and fuel injection components. Other applications include plumbing fixtures, musical instruments, and decorative hardware, where both functionality and appearance are important.

Maintenance and Precautions

To ensure longevity, conductive brass rods should be stored in a dry environment to prevent tarnishing or oxidation. Regular cleaning with a mild detergent can help maintain their appearance and conductivity. Avoid exposing brass rods to highly acidic or alkaline environments, as this can lead to corrosion. When machining brass rods, use appropriate lubricants to reduce friction and prevent overheating, which can affect material properties.

B2B Procurement Guide

When procuring conductive brass rods, consider factors such as alloy composition, diameter, length, and surface finish. Verify the supplier's certifications to ensure material quality and consistency. Bulk purchases often come with cost advantages, so negotiate pricing based on volume. Lead times can vary depending on customization requirements, so plan orders accordingly. Always request material test reports (MTRs) to confirm the properties of the brass rods.
